diff options
author | Eric Biggers <ebiggers@google.com> | 2021-06-15 21:53:31 -0700 |
---|---|---|
committer | Theodore Ts'o <tytso@mit.edu> | 2021-07-06 22:43:25 -0400 |
commit | 108f3021a6b68a86eae3bd9da7f9ce8a1568ce50 (patch) | |
tree | 24593dc9984c33080e454e2263b1793f969d60d6 | |
parent | 6c60acbb945701a08373bee5b0689563eedf6ed2 (diff) | |
download | e2fsprogs-108f3021a6b68a86eae3bd9da7f9ce8a1568ce50.tar.gz |
mke2fs: use ext2fs_get_device_size2() on all platforms
Since commit e8c858047be6 ("libext2fs: fix build issue for on
Windows/Cygwin systems"), ext2fs_get_device_size2() is available in
Windows builds of libext2fs. So there is no need for mke2fs to call
ext2fs_get_device_size() instead.
This fixes a -Wincompatible-pointer-types warning because
ext2fs_get_device_size() was being passed a 'blk64_t *', but it expected
a 'blk_t *'.
Signed-off-by: Eric Biggers <ebiggers@google.com>
Signed-off-by: Theodore Ts'o <tytso@mit.edu>
-rw-r--r-- | misc/mke2fs.c | 6 |
1 files changed, 0 insertions, 6 deletions
diff --git a/misc/mke2fs.c b/misc/mke2fs.c index afbcf486b..d5ab334ed 100644 --- a/misc/mke2fs.c +++ b/misc/mke2fs.c @@ -1989,15 +1989,9 @@ profile_error: dev_size = fs_blocks_count; retval = 0; } else -#ifndef _WIN32 retval = ext2fs_get_device_size2(device_name, EXT2_BLOCK_SIZE(&fs_param), &dev_size); -#else - retval = ext2fs_get_device_size(device_name, - EXT2_BLOCK_SIZE(&fs_param), - &dev_size); -#endif if (retval && (retval != EXT2_ET_UNIMPLEMENTED)) { com_err(program_name, retval, "%s", _("while trying to determine filesystem size")); |